I just purchased the Saratoga today and have done several quick flights to check her out and I really like the aircraft except for the fact that I'm getting a tiny stutter every second or so. It's happening even with Frame-rates in the 20's. I loaded up the exact same flight with different aircraft (both default and addons) and did not experience these stutters. The stutters are in both the VC and when viewing the aircraft externally. Has anyone else experienced this, and if so, is there a way to solve the stutters?I appreciate any suggestions.Thanks. December 28, 201015 yr Author I figured it out myself.The stutters are caused by the GPS unit. The GPS doesn't cause this in any other aircraft. Not sure why Carenado's is the only one. Perhaps a Carenado rep can explain it someday.In any case, I went into the Panel.cfg folder and took out the GPS by adding the "//" before the line, as follows:[Vcockpit03]Background_color=0,0,0 size_mm=512,512visible=0pixel_size=1024,1024texture=$Panel_archer_3//gauge00=FSGPSCarenado3!gps_500, 7,6,369,310 Alexander Alonso
December 28, 201015 yr Haha I was going to post something about it being the GPS but my browser crashed and I didn't feel like retyping all of it.The default GPS (and any other gauges that use its map) hit fps and cause stutters pretty bad (despite having a slowwwwwwwwww refresh rate). For example when I got rid of the default GPS in the Realair Duke and I added in the RXP GNS430W, my fps went up by at least 5 and it was a lot smoother. Tired of Streetlights everywhere?
